    FS: 818S Initial Release Body Style, Registered, Tagged and on the Road in MD

    I'm finally putting my 818S up for sale. Very sad to let it go, but I'm moving and we won't have space for me to store or work on it for the foreseeable future. Registered, titled and legally on the road in Maryland.

    Installed extras:
    -Soft top
    -Air-to-water intercooler
    -MR2 shifter (MUCH nicer than stock FFR shifter and cables)
    -Windshield wiper, single arm, installed *without cutting* the hood! The install also added an extra support that means there is *no* hood flop or shake *at all*.
    -Cobb Access Port, currently set to stage 2, which makes it crazy fast, but manageable
    -2002 WRX 2.0 liter donor (135K miles on the motor, under-stressed in this tiny car, runs great and strong)
    -5-Speed WRX transmission with upgraded gear set from Andrew Tech for max reliability

    I also have an OBX LSD ready to go in the tranny.

    I am only letting this go because I'm moving cross country. I love this thing, and will build another (or maybe an FFR Cobra) when I get the space and time.
